We are currently working on behalf of our client, one of the largest registered providers of supported housing working throughout East, West and Southwest London, for an experienced Property Inspector. This is a full-time 35 hours per week, 6-month fixed term contract and offers hybrid work with 1 or 2 days being carried out at home. The successful candidate will have valid drivers license and vehicle as well as an enhanced DBS check carried out. Responsibilities will include: * To carry out stock condition surveys and property inspections for the group as agreed, producing reports to help maintain and refresh the organisation’s asset management information and asset investment programme * To undertake surveys and works inspections for the capital and cyclical programme to support effective contract management and ensure quality and VfM standards are met * To produce reports to identify defects, maintenance, compliance and capital investment * Ensure compliance and statutory obligations are picked up and met and recommendations * To produce financial reports on stock investment and liaise with the Head of Property Management, Asset Manager and the Planned and Cyclical Works Manager to develop asset investment plans * To review Fire Risk Audit (FRA) reports and help ensure actions and remedial works are scoped and completed, updating relevant system * Help produce reports for both internal and external audits with relevant asset management data * Keep the Job Logic (repairs, asset and compliance) system up to date with any Asset changes as a result of surveys * Carryout HHSRS (housing health & safety rating system) inspections followed with a recommendations and status report * Ensure all recommendations supplied from any report (FRA, stock condition, HHSRS) are followed through with the responsible delivery teams and are actions are completed * To keep up to date with all regulatory requirements and changes in legislation * To deputise for the Head of Health & Safety when required * To collate and report on overall monthly/quarterly and annual performance indicators for each compliance work stream completion quality checks are conducted, and the results of such checks recorded and used to improve performance * To work with the Head of Property Management and others involved in the management of the buildings in order to manage building safety risks appropriately * To help identify priorities and align resources to ensure regulatory requirements are prioritised
